Here are the steps that you could follow to ensure that you prevent an infestation of bedbugs in your home.

  1. The first thing that you should do is carefully inspect all the areas in your house that tend to be warm or are usually in close proximity to human contact. These will include pillows, mattresses, sofa beds, chairs, and so on. This inspection is to check that you already do not have an infestation in your hands. Once the inspection is done, you can then proceed to treating all the furniture that is used on a regular basis. You can do this with a generic insecticide spray but if you would like to be more thorough, you should opt for insecticide dust.
  2. Once you have treated the pieces of furniture, you should tend to the mattresses in your home. Bedbugs tend to hide in them so you would be best advised to cover all of them in some plastic. This prevents any of these pests from getting into the mattress plus if there were any inside, they cannot get out and harm you.
  3. Lastly, ensure that all the cracks and crevices in the walls of our home have been sealed with some caulking material. Bedbugs tend to choose these places as hiding places thus if you eliminate the hiding places, they will have nowhere to seek haven.
